Output c326d90a9539ce1b89ceacd59c7a9f1c15e6bac9bedbabae4466a4add3595e42:2

value
578415500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 278cdb348e0b70f10815936f84dda2f4ba18fc96 OP_EQUALVERIFY OP_CHECKSIG
address
D8kDdc3mVYcV5Bmpfvi88h9z2wavvcxW49
transaction
c326d90a9539ce1b89ceacd59c7a9f1c15e6bac9bedbabae4466a4add3595e42